What Is Citric Acid?

Citric acid (C₆H₈O₇) is a weak organic acid naturally occurring in lemons, limes, and other citrus fruits. Industrial production is carried out through microbial fermentation, primarily using Aspergillus niger, resulting in high-purity food-grade citric acid.

Key Characteristics

  • Appearance: Colourless, white crystalline powder or granular form

  • Taste: Strongly acidic with a sharp, clean sourness

  • Solubility: Highly soluble in water

  • Functionality: Acidulant, chelating agent, stabilizer, antioxidant synergist

  • Forms: Anhydrous and monohydrate varieties

Because of its pleasant tart flavour and excellent safety profile, citric acid is one of the most common additives in food formulations worldwide.

What are the Benefits of Citric Acid (Lemon Salt) for the Food Industry?

Acidulant and pH Control

Citric acid is widely used to adjust acidity in foods and beverages.


It provides:


  • Control over microbial growth

  • Improved product stability

  • Enhanced shelf life

  • Accurate pH adjustments in formulations


Its clean, refreshing acidity makes it especially suitable for beverages, confectionery, and fruit-flavoured products.

 

Flavour Enhancer


Citric acid boosts and balances flavour by:


  • Intensifying fruit notes

  • Enhancing sweetness perception

  • Providing a refreshing sourness

  • Masking off-notes in complex formulations


It is essential in soft drinks, candies, syrups, and flavoured water.

 

Preservative and Antioxidant Synergist


Citric acid acts as a chelating agent, binding metal ions that catalyse oxidation. This helps:


  • Prevent rancidity in oils and fats

  • Maintain colour and freshness in fruit products

  • Stabilize flavours and vitamins

  • Improve the effect of other antioxidants


Its preservative role is especially important in long-shelf-life foods and beverages.

 

Texture and Gelling Control


Citric acid is used in combination with pectins and gelling agents to:


  • Set jams, jellies, and marmalades

  • Improve firmness in fruit-based products

  • Stabilize dairy products and desserts


Its acidification effect activates pectin’s gelling properties.

 

Leavening Agent Component


Citric acid is often included in effervescent tablets, baking powders, and instant beverages. When combined with sodium bicarbonate, it produces carbon dioxide, creating:


  • Effervescence

  • Lightness in baked goods

  • Fizzy beverage effects

 

Common Applications in the Food Industry


Citric acid is used in nearly every food category:


  • Soft drinks, energy drinks, flavoured waters

  • Jams, jellies, fruit preserves

  • Candies, gummies, and confectionery

  • Dairy products (cheese, ice cream)

  • Processed fruits and canned vegetables

  • Bakery products

  • Sauces, dressings, marinades

  • Meat and seafood processing (as a pH regulator and antioxidant synergist)


Its versatility makes it indispensable across both industrial and consumer product formulations.

 

Product Presentation and Commercial Forms


Citric acid is available in a variety of grades and formats tailored to different applications.


Citric Acid Anhydrous


  • Low moisture content

  • Preferred in dry mixes, powders, bakery goods, and tablets


Citric Acid Monohydrate


  • Slightly larger particles

  • Common in beverages, syrups, and liquid formulations


Fine Powder Grade


  • Rapid solubility

  • Used in instant beverages, effervescent formulations, and confectionery


Granular Grade


  • Low dust, excellent flow

  • Ideal for high-speed production lines and food processing equipment


Coated Citric Acid


  • Modified release profile

  • Used in bakery and moisture-sensitive formulas to prevent premature reactions


Quality Standards


Most food-grade citric acid complies with:


  • FCC

  • USP/EP

  • E330 (EU food additive)

  • GB standards

 

Storage and Handling


To maintain quality and strength:


  • Store in a cool, dry place

  • Keep away from moisture and metal contamination

  • Use airtight packaging such as PE-lined bags or fibre drums


Citric acid is hygroscopic, so moisture control is essential.

 

Market Trends and Industry Insights


Demand for citric acid continues to rise due to:


  • Growth of the global beverage market

  • Increased consumption of flavoured and functional foods

  • Clean-label preference for natural or naturally-derived acids

  • Expansion of processed food production

  • Rising use in natural preservation systems


Citric acid’s safety, versatility, and cost-effectiveness ensure its ongoing dominance in the acidulant category.
